Covid-19: EU countries agree on technical specifications of Digital Green Certificate

One month after the European Commission’s proposal for a Digital Green Certificate, representatives in the eHealth Network agreed on guidelines describing the main technical specifications for the implementation of the system, the Commission said on April 22. This is a crucial step for the establishment of the necessary infrastructure at EU level, the Commission said. The European Commission set out on March 17 its proposal for the creation of a Digital Green Certificate to facilitate safe free movement inside the European Union during the Covid-19 pandemic. Bulgaria's Medicines Agency head: 5.5M doses of Covid-19 vaccines coming by end of June

Deliveries to Bulgaria of about 5.5 million doses of vaccines against Covid-19 are expected by the end of June, Medicines Agency head Bogdan Kirilov said in an interview with Bulgarian National Television on April 21. Kirilov said that next week, about 140 000 doses of BioNTech-Pfizer vaccine against Covid-19 would be delivered to Bulgaria, followed by 270 000 each week in May and up to 410 000 doses in June. Covid-19: 106 more deaths, active cases decrease again

A total of 106 people in Bulgaria who had tested positive for Covid-19 died in the past 24 hours, bringing the country’s death toll linked to the disease to 15 518, according to the April 21 report by the national information system. To date, 390 911 cases of new coronavirus have been confirmed in Bulgaria, counting in those who have died, the active cases and those who have recovered from the virus. Covid-19 in Bulgaria: 217 deaths registered in past 24 hours

The deaths of 217 people in Bulgaria who had tested positive for Covid-19 were registered in the past 24 hours, bringing the country’s death toll linked to the disease to 15 412, according to the April 20 report by the national information system. Of 15 952 tests done in the past day, 2434 – about 15.3 per cent – proved positive. To date, 388 815 cases of new coronavirus have been confirmed in Bulgaria, counting in the deaths, the active cases and those who have recovered from the virus.
